China Southern orders 102 A320neo, Xiamen orders 35
China Southern Airlines (CZ, Guangzhou) and its subsidiary Xiamen Airlines (MF, Xiamen) have ordered a total of 137 aircraft from Airbus, China Southern revealed in a stock exchange filing. A total of 102 A320neo aircraft will go to China Southern, while Xiamen’s fleet will be updated with 35 of the type.
